域名如何连接主机

要连接域名和主机,首先在域名注册商处将域名解析到主机的IP地址。通过添加A记录或CNAME记录实现,A记录直接指向IP,CNAME指向另一个域名。配置完成后,等待DNS解析生效,通常需数小时。确保主机已设置好网站文件和必要的DNS配置,如MX记录(邮件服务)。最后,检查连接是否成功,可通过ping命令验证。

imagesource from: pexels

域名与主机连接:开启网络世界之门

域名与主机的连接,如同网络世界的基石,是构建在线业务、个人品牌的重要一环。在这个数字时代,拥有一个易于记忆、独特的域名,并确保其与高效稳定的主机连接,成为每个网站拥有者的基本需求。本文将深入浅出地解析域名与主机连接的基本概念,详细解答如何实现这一连接,旨在激发读者对这一领域的兴趣,并助您在网络世界中稳步前行。

一、域名与主机连接的基础知识

1、什么是域名

域名,顾名思义,就是网站的名称。在互联网上,每一个网站都有一个唯一的IP地址,但IP地址由一串数字组成,不仅难以记忆,而且不够直观。因此,人们为了方便记忆和识别,将IP地址与一个更容易理解的名称相对应,这个名称就是域名。例如,www.baidu.com就是一个域名,它对应着百度网站的实际IP地址。

2、什么是主机

主机,是指存储网站文件的服务器。当用户在浏览器中输入一个域名时,浏览器会通过域名解析找到对应的主机IP地址,然后将请求发送到该主机,从而获取网站内容。主机可以是物理服务器,也可以是云服务器。

3、域名与主机连接的意义

域名与主机的连接对于网站的正常运行至关重要。只有将域名解析到正确的主机IP地址,用户才能通过访问域名来访问网站。以下是域名与主机连接的几个关键意义:

  1. 便于用户记忆和访问:通过域名访问网站,用户无需记住复杂的IP地址,提高了用户体验。
  2. 便于网站品牌建设:独特的域名可以帮助网站树立品牌形象,提升品牌知名度。
  3. 提高网站安全性:域名解析过程中,可以设置安全策略,防止域名劫持和恶意攻击。
  4. 便于搜索引擎优化:搜索引擎通过域名识别网站,正确解析域名与主机的连接有利于提高网站在搜索引擎中的排名。

了解域名与主机连接的基础知识,为后续的域名解析和主机配置提供了必要的前提。在下一部分,我们将详细介绍域名解析的基本步骤。

二、域名解析的基本步骤

1、选择域名注册商

在开始域名解析之前,首先需要选择一家可靠的域名注册商。注册商不仅提供域名注册服务,还提供域名解析管理功能。以下是一些选择域名注册商时需要考虑的因素:

  • 信誉与稳定性:选择知名度高、口碑好的注册商,确保域名服务稳定可靠。
  • 解析功能:了解注册商提供的解析功能,如A记录、CNAME记录、MX记录等。
  • 价格与服务:比较不同注册商的价格和服务,选择性价比高的方案。

2、获取主机的IP地址

在域名解析过程中,需要将域名指向主机的IP地址。以下是获取主机IP地址的几种方法:

  • 向主机服务商咨询:联系主机服务商,获取主机的公网IP地址。
  • 查询域名DNS记录:使用在线工具查询域名的DNS记录,获取A记录中的IP地址。
  • ping命令:使用ping命令检测主机是否可达,从而获取IP地址。

3、添加A记录或CNAME记录

根据需求,可以选择添加A记录或CNAME记录实现域名解析。

  • A记录:将域名指向主机IP地址,适用于直接指向IP的解析。
  • CNAME记录:将域名指向另一个域名,适用于指向其他网站或服务的解析。

在域名注册商的控制面板中,找到域名解析管理页面,添加相应的记录即可。需要注意的是,添加记录后,DNS解析生效需要一段时间,通常为几小时到一天不等。

三、DNS解析生效与等待时间

1、DNS解析的过程

DNS解析是一个复杂的过程,涉及多个步骤。首先,当用户在浏览器中输入域名时,浏览器会向本地DNS服务器发送请求。如果本地DNS服务器没有缓存该域名的IP地址,它将继续向根DNS服务器查询。根DNS服务器将请求转发到顶级域名(TLD)服务器,例如.com、.org等。然后,TLD服务器将请求转发到授权DNS服务器,该服务器负责处理特定域名的查询。最后,授权DNS服务器返回域名的IP地址,本地DNS服务器将此信息缓存,并返回给浏览器。

2、常见的DNS解析时间

DNS解析的时间取决于多个因素,包括网络延迟、DNS服务器的性能以及请求的复杂性。通常,DNS解析时间在几秒到几十秒之间。以下是一些常见的DNS解析时间:

请求类型 平均解析时间
一次性查询 0.5 – 2秒
常见查询(缓存) 0.1 – 0.5秒
复杂查询(例如,包含CNAME记录) 2 – 10秒

请注意,DNS解析时间并非固定不变,它会根据网络状况、服务器性能等因素波动。因此,建议用户在等待DNS解析生效时,保持耐心。

四、主机端的配置要求

1. 网站文件的部署

在完成域名解析后,下一步是确保网站文件已正确部署在主机上。这包括上传HTML、CSS、JavaScript等静态文件,以及服务器端语言(如PHP、Python)的脚本。以下是一些关键步骤:

  • 使用FTP或SSH:通过FTP(文件传输协议)或SSH(安全外壳协议)连接到主机,将本地文件上传到服务器。
  • 选择正确的目录:通常,网站文件应放置在主目录下(如/public_html/www)。
  • 检查文件权限:确保所有文件和目录具有正确的权限,以允许服务器正确访问。

2. 必要的DNS配置(如MX记录)

除了A记录和CNAME记录外,某些情况下还需要其他DNS记录。以下是一些可能需要的记录:

  • MX记录:用于指定邮件服务器,以便接收电子邮件。
  • TXT记录:用于验证域名的所有权,通常用于电子邮件验证。
  • SPF记录:用于防止垃圾邮件发送,通过指定允许发送邮件的服务器。

以下是一个MX记录的示例:

记录类型 主机名 记录值 TTL
MX @ mail.yourdomain.com 3600

确保正确配置这些记录,以避免邮件发送失败或其他服务中断。

五、验证域名与主机的连接

1. 使用ping命令检查

验证域名与主机的连接,最直接的方法是使用ping命令。在命令行界面输入ping 域名,如果能够成功ping通,说明域名与主机的连接是正常的。

以下是一个简单的ping命令示例:

ping www.example.com

如果ping的结果显示如下:

Ping www.example.com [IP地址] 字节=32 时间=10ms TTL=128

则说明域名与主机的连接已经建立成功。

2. 其他验证方法

除了ping命令,还可以使用以下方法验证域名与主机的连接:

  • 浏览器访问:在浏览器中输入域名,如果能够正常访问网站,说明连接成功。
  • 网络诊断工具:使用网络诊断工具,如Google PageSpeed Insights、GTmetrix等,可以检测网站的性能和连接状态。
  • DNS查询工具:使用DNS查询工具,如DNS Stuff、Whatismydns等,可以查询域名对应的IP地址,从而判断连接是否成功。

总结

验证域名与主机的连接是确保网站正常访问的重要步骤。通过使用ping命令和其他验证方法,可以确保域名与主机的连接稳定可靠。在实际操作中,建议定期检查连接状态,确保网站能够正常访问。

结语

总结来说,域名与主机的连接是一个相对简单但关键的过程。通过选择合适的域名注册商,获取主机的IP地址,添加A记录或CNAME记录,以及等待DNS解析生效,我们就能实现域名与主机的成功连接。在这个过程中,正确的配置和耐心等待是至关重要的。因此,我们鼓励读者在实际操作中多加练习,不断熟悉这一过程,以确保网站能够顺利上线并服务于广大用户。记住,只有掌握了这一基础技能,我们才能更好地应对网络世界的挑战。

常见问题

1、域名解析失败怎么办?

当遇到域名解析失败的情况时,首先检查域名是否已经注册并正确解析到主机的IP地址。可以尝试以下步骤:

  • 确认域名是否已注册并续费。
  • 检查域名解析记录是否正确设置,包括A记录和CNAME记录。
  • 确认主机IP地址是否正确。
  • 等待DNS解析生效,通常需数小时。

如果以上步骤均无法解决问题,建议联系域名注册商或主机服务商寻求帮助。

2、DNS解析时间过长如何处理?

DNS解析时间过长可能是由以下原因导致的:

  • DNS解析记录尚未生效。
  • DNS服务器配置错误。
  • 网络延迟。

针对以上原因,可以尝试以下解决方法:

  • 等待DNS解析生效,通常需数小时。
  • 检查DNS服务器配置,确保正确无误。
  • 检查网络连接,确保网络稳定。

如果问题依然存在,建议联系DNS服务商或网络运营商寻求帮助。

3、如何更改域名解析记录?

更改域名解析记录可以通过以下步骤实现:

  1. 登录域名注册商的控制面板。
  2. 进入域名解析管理页面。
  3. 修改相应的A记录或CNAME记录。
  4. 点击保存或更新。

更改解析记录后,DNS解析记录需要一段时间才能生效,通常为数小时。

4、主机配置错误如何排查?

主机配置错误可能导致网站无法正常访问。以下是一些排查主机配置错误的步骤:

  1. 检查网站文件是否正确上传到主机。
  2. 检查主机服务是否正常运行。
  3. 检查网站代码是否存在错误。
  4. 检查主机防火墙设置,确保网站端口未被封锁。

如果以上步骤均无法解决问题,建议联系主机服务商寻求帮助。

原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/67865.html

(0)
上一篇 1天前
下一篇 1天前

相关推荐

  • js如何获取点击的位置

    在JavaScript中,获取点击位置可通过监听点击事件并使用`event.clientX`和`event.clientY`属性实现。例如,绑定点击事件:`document.addEventListener(‘click’, function(event) { console.log(‘X:’, event.clientX, ‘Y:’, event.clientY); });`,这样点击页面任意位置时,控制台会显示点击的X和Y坐标。

    8秒前
    0426
  • 如何添加应用程序池

    要在IIS中添加应用程序池,首先打开IIS管理器,选择左侧的’应用程序池’,点击右侧的’添加应用程序池’。输入池名称,选择.NET CLR版本和托管管道模式,点击’确定’即可创建。接着,在网站设置中,将应用程序绑定到新创建的应用程序池,确保应用程序正常运行。

    9秒前
    0297
  • 柳钢移动OA如何下载

    要下载柳钢移动OA,首先在手机应用商店搜索“柳钢移动OA”,找到官方应用并点击下载安装。确保手机系统兼容,完成后打开应用,使用公司提供的账号密码登录即可使用。如遇下载问题,可访问柳钢官网或联系IT部门获取帮助。

    24秒前
    0460
  • 员工如何推广公司微信

    员工可通过分享公司微信公众号的文章到个人朋友圈,利用高质量的原创内容吸引关注;定期在微信群内进行互动,提供有价值的信息,增强用户粘性;同时,结合公司活动进行线上线下推广,增加微信号的曝光度。

    47秒前
    0387
  • 网页设计字体如何居右

    在网页设计中,将字体居右可以通过CSS样式实现。使用text-align属性,设置为right即可。例如:`div { text-align: right; }`。此外,还可以通过Flexbox布局,设置justify-content为flex-end,达到类似效果。确保在不同设备和浏览器上测试,以确保一致性和兼容性。

    51秒前
    0283
  • 如何保证网站安全传输

    保证网站安全传输,首先要启用HTTPS协议,使用SSL/TLS证书加密数据。确保服务器配置正确,及时更新证书,防止过期。此外,采用强密码策略和双因素认证,增强账户安全。定期进行安全漏洞扫描和渗透测试,及时发现并修复漏洞。最后,监控网络流量,防范DDoS攻击,确保网站稳定运行。

    58秒前
    0446
  • html如何实现倒计时

    要实现HTML倒计时,可以使用JavaScript。首先,在HTML中创建一个显示倒计时的元素。然后在JavaScript中,使用`setInterval`函数来每秒更新时间。通过计算目标时间与当前时间的差值,将其转换为天、小时、分钟和秒,并更新HTML元素的内容。示例代码:`

    ` 和 `var countdown = setInterval(function() { var now = new Date().getTime(); var distance = endTime – now; var days = Math.floor(distance / (1000 * 60 * 60 * 24)); var hours = Math.floor((distance % (1000 * 60 * 60 * 24)) / (1000 * 60 * 60)); var minutes = Math.floor((distance % (1000 * 60 * 60)) / (1000 * 60)); var seconds = Math.floor((distance % (1000 * 60)) / 1000); document.getElementById(‘countdown’).innerHTML = days + ‘天 ‘ + hours + ‘小时 ‘ + minutes + ‘分钟 ‘ + seconds + ‘秒 ‘; if (distance < 0) { clearInterval(countdown); document.getElementById('countdown').innerHTML = '倒计时结束'; } }, 1000);`。

    1分钟前
    0460
  • phpcms如何防范js挂马

    要防范phpcms中的JS挂马,首先确保系统更新到最新版本,修补已知漏洞。其次,使用强密码并定期更换,防止后台被非法登录。安装可靠的防病毒软件,定期扫描服务器。最后,对上传文件进行严格检查,禁用执行权限,避免恶意脚本执行。

    1分钟前
    0117
  • 商昊贸易公司如何

    商昊贸易公司通过优化供应链管理、拓展国际市场、提升产品质量和客户服务,实现稳步增长。公司注重数据分析,精准定位市场需求,灵活调整策略,确保高效运营。

    1分钟前
    0352

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注